Studies have shown that garlic and ginger have strong heart-protective properties and may help decrease some risk factors of heart disease, including ( elevated blood pressure high cholesterol high blood sugar levels A 2014 review of 22 high quality studies found that consuming garlic powder significantly reduced levels of total and LDL (bad) cholesterol, as well as fasting blood sugar and blood pressure levels ( Other studies have shown that garlic helps reduce blood pressure, blood sugar, and cholesterol, and that it helps prevent atherosclerosis, or the buildup of plaque in the arteries ( Studies have also linked ginger to heart health benefits
